August 23rd, 2005 11:30 AM #7lienahtan: on the Innova thread, many J-owners have already installed accessories like me, meier, smooth, geo, etc. It's just a pain to go through the entire thread looking for their posts.
Yes, I have installed foglamps on my Innova-J. I had them installed at an auto acc. store along Malugay, here in Makati for P3,000.- The kit includes a push-switch that is slaved to the front headlights. When you turn on your front headlight, even at dim, the push-switch get lit up (there's a LED behind the push-switch). Only then will your foglamps become functional.

here's a quick price list of Innova accessories from Malugay stores
(prices include installation) :
mudguards: P1,000
back-up sensors with mini LCD display :P3,000
back-up sensors with rearview mirror display: P3,800
central locks (5pcs incl. tailgate) :P1,500
central locks with keyless entry : P2,200
central locks with alarm :P3,800 (cobra)
power windows (front pair only) : P3,800
tail light chrome garnish : P1,400
rear spoiler with LED lights : P6,000
rain gutter : P1,200
tailgate latch chrome garnish : P1,000
chrome side mirrors (pair) : P1,300
side step boards : P5,500
shark front bumper guard : P11,500
I've heard that these accessories are cheaper in Banawe by P100~P400 per item above, so if you're having many accessories installed then its Banawe for you.
Also pls. consider the quality workmanship of the installer and their methods-this counts a lot specially with the central locks.
